Ocean Renewable Power Company (ORPC) is Maine company that develops ocean and river power systems.
According to this NRDC blog post, ORPC’s Cobscook Bay tidal energy project in the Bay of Fundy in Maine is the first in the U.S. to receive a FERC license, include a power purchase agreement, and install and